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Sarnia to Prince Rupert is to drive which costs $850 - $1,300 and takes 2 days 4h.
The fastest way to get from Sarnia to Prince Rupert is to train and fly and bus which takes 15h 43m and costs $700 - $3,800.
The distance between Sarnia and Prince Rupert is 3892 km. The road distance is 4480.5 km.
The best way to get from Sarnia to Prince Rupert without a car is to bus and train which takes 4 days 16h and costs $1,100 - $2,400.
It takes approximately 15h 43m to get from Sarnia to Prince Rupert, including transfers.
Prince Rupert is 3h behind Sarnia. It is currently 1:33 AM in Sarnia and 10:33 PM in Prince Rupert.
Yes, the driving distance between Sarnia to Prince Rupert is 4481 km. It takes approximately 2 days 4h to drive from Sarnia to Prince Rupert.
